Exploring NXTGEN Breakthroughs Beyond Established Protein Fragments
The field of peptide research is rapidly evolving, shifting outside the boundaries of established peptide creation. New technologies are impacting a surge of NXTGEN breakthroughs, presenting groundbreaking approaches to peptide alteration and usage. These encompass ring formation techniques permitting for superior resilience and bioavailability, modified amino acid inclusion to engineer peptides with targeted properties, and advanced delivery systems to secure effective medicinal effect. Further expansion focuses on systems for large-scale peptide creation and tailored peptide therapies.
